#3  A different Virginia Hall you should know about.

Virginia Hall MBE DSC (April 6, 1906 - July 14, 1982) was an American spy during World War II. She was also known by many aliases: "Marie Monin", "Germaine", "Diane", and "Camille."[1] The Germans gave her the nickname Artemis. The Gestapo considered her "the most dangerous of all allied spies."[2]

She was born in Baltimore, Maryland and attended prestigious Radcliffe College and Barnard College (Columbia University)[3], but wanted to finish her studies in Europe. With help from her parents, she traveled the Continent and studied in France, Germany, and Austria, finally landing an appointment as a Consular Service clerk at the American Embassy in Warsaw, Poland in 1931. Hall hoped to join the Foreign Service, but suffered a terrible setback around 1932 when she accidentally shot herself in the left leg while hunting in Turkey. It was later amputated from the knee down, and replaced with a wooden appendage she named "Cuthbert."[4] The injury foreclosed whatever chance she might have had for a diplomatic career, and she resigned from the Department of State in 1939.

2 Rockets Hit Herat City
[Tolo News] Taliban Insurgents launched rocket attacks on Herat city, the picturesque provincial capital of the western Herat province said on Tuesday night

The front man to the governor of Herat, Naqibullah Arween, and the province's deputy commander of police, Delawar Shah Delawar, confirmed the news adding that the attacks were carried out around 08:00pm last night, which had no casualties.

"The rockets were aimed at the Italian Provincial Reconstruction Team's office, but the rockets hit residential areas, only smashing windows," said Delawar Shah Delawar.

No anti-government armed group has so far grabbed credit for the attacks.

Police officials in Herat say they have discovered and defused another rocket that was also set to be launched on the city.

Insurgents have escalated their attacks to target government institutions in different parts of the country, and just recently carried out several attacks during the Afghan parliamentary polls to disrupt the elections.

US runs Afghan force to hunt militants in Pakistan: official
A very clever idea, I think. Someone in the CIA is to be congratulated for coming up with the idea, and then keeping it secret until the president's people spilled the beans to dear Mr. Woodward..
[Dawn] The Central Intelligence Agency runs an Afghan paramilitary force that hunts down Al-Qaeda and Taliban Islamic snuffies in covert operations in Pakistain, a US official said Wednesday.

Confirming an account in a new book by famed reporter Bob Woodward, the US official told AFP that the Counterterrorism Pursuit Teams were highly effective but did not offer details.

"This is one of the best Afghan fighting forces and it's made major contributions to stability and security," said the official, who spoke on condition of anonymity.

The 3,000-strong paramilitary army of Afghan soldiers was created and bankrolled by the CIA and was designed as an "elite" unit to pursue "highly sensitive covert operations into Pakistain" in the fight against Al-Qaeda and Taliban sanctuaries, according to The Washington Post, which revealed details of the new book.

US President Barack B.O. Obama has sought to pile pressure on Islamic exemplar havens in Pakistain through a stepped up bombing campaign using unmanned aircraft as well as US special forces' operations in Afghan territory.

The administration also has pressed the Mighty Pak army to go after the Taliban and associated groups in the northwest tribal belt.

Revelations about a US-run unit operating in Pakistain are sure to complicate Washington's ties with Islamabad as well as Kabul's difficult relations with Pakistain.

Al-Qaeda claims French kidnappings
[Al Jazeera] Al-Qaeda in the Islamic Maghreb (AQIM) has claimed the abduction of five French nationals in Niger and said that it will make demands to France regarding them.

"In announcing our claim for this operation, we inform the French government that the mujahedeen will later transmit their legitimate demands," a voice claiming to be AQIM front man Salah Abi Mohammed said in an audio message released on Tuesday.

"We also warn [the French government] against any sort of stupidity," he added, in reference to a possible military operation, as French military planes patrolled the desert on Tuesday in an effort to locate the group.

The statement, which did not mention the two African hostages, added that Abdelhamid Abou Zeid, an Algerian, led the kidnap operation.

"Following the promise of our emir, Abou Moussab [Algerian Abdelmalek Droukdel], a group of heroic mujahedeen last Wednesday, under the command of Sheikh Abou Zeid, succeeded in penetrating the French mining site at Arlit in Niger," the message said.

France confirms claims

France has authenticated the claim, and says it has good reason to believe the hostages are alive.

"We are in a position to confirm the authenticity of the claim," Romain Nadal, a French foreign ministry front man said on Wednesday.

"We have not received proof of life, but we have good reasons to believe the hostages are alive."

He said he was not aware of any demands from the hostage takers.

AQIM, which is active in the Sahara and the arid Sahel region, has been increasingly targeting French interests.

The claim came hours after Niger's government front man, Mahamane Laouali Dan Dah, said the hostages - also including a citizen of Togo and another from Madagascar - were still alive.

He did not say what that information was based on.

All seven hostages had worked at a huge uranium mine in northern Niger run by French state-owned nuclear power giant Areva. They were kidnapped by gunnies last Thursday.

6 soldiers, 2 al-Qaida fighters killed in clashes in Yemen besieged Hota
(Xinhua) -- At least six soldiers and two al- Qaeda gunnies were killed in fierce clashes on Wednesday between the Yemeni government troops and al-Qaeda forces of Evil in the suburb of the besieged southeast Hota town, a local security official said.

"Among the two confirmed killed al-Qaeda forces of Evil is a son of terrorist Abdullah al-Mihdhar who was killed nearly seven months ago in clashes with the security forces in Hota," the official told Xinhua on condition of anonymity.

"Hota town of the southeast province of Shabwa is definitely empty now of local residents who decamped yesterday (Tuesday), and there will be a massive offensive including air strikes to flush out the area and bring inevitable death to those 300 subversive beturbanned goons who holed up in the town," he said.

On Tuesday, a provincial security official told Xinhua that a combined force consisting of more than 1,500 Yemeni soldiers from counter-terrorism units, security foot soldiers and army infantry are tightening siege on the al-Qaeda gunnies holed up in Hota in preparation to strike them.

"The back-up combined force arrived at the area Tuesday afternoon and were deployed around Hota, the third biggest town in the southeast of Shabwa picturesque provincial capital of Ataq, after a total of 20,000 local residents decamped their homes in the morning to dodge the imminent battle," the official said, adding "the town is empty except al-Qaeda gunnies."

According to intelligence reports, as many as 200 al-Qaeda forces of Evil arrived in the town during the past three nights from northeast province Marib and southern province Abyan, bringing the total number of al-Qaeda gunnies there to about 300, he said.

Yemen, the ancestral homeland of al-Qaeda network leader Osama bin Laden, has witnessed a series of deadly attacks by al-Qaeda group since late last year.

The Yemeni government has intensified security operations and air raids against terrorist groups after the Yemen-based al-Qaeda wing claimed for an attempt to blow up a U.S.-bound passenger plane last December. Enditem

Court orders arrest of 4 policemen
[Bangla Daily Star] A Dhaka court yesterday issued arrest warrants against the then Officer-in-charge (OC) Mahbubur Rahman of Ramna Police Station and three other police officials for implicating and torturing a Dhaka University student for "attempting to kill" Prof Humayun Azad.

The three other officials are sub-inspectors Rezaul Karim and Naser Ali of Ramna cop shoppe and Sergeant Anwar Hossain who was in charge of Nilkhet police box.

Metropolitan Magistrate Mehedi Hasan Talukder passed the order after Criminal Investigation Department (CID) of police submitted a report.

The court also directed the OC of Ramna cop shoppe to submit a report by October 26 on execution of arrest warrants against the then OC and three other accused.

Ehsan Uddin Chowdhury, CID inspector and investigation officer (IO) of the case, submitted the probe reports on Tuesday saying that the charges brought against the four police officials were primarily proved and they should be brought to justice.

But the IO excluded detained former state minister for home Lutfozzaman Babar from the charge finding no connection of him.

A gang of myrmidons attacked Prof Humayun Azad in front of Bangla Academy when he was on his way back home on February 27, 2004 leaving him seriously injured.

Later on February 28, police jugged Mohammad Abu Abbas Bhuiyan, Mass Education Affairs' secretary of Bangladesh Chhatra League central committee for attacking Humayun Azad. Later, he was remanded and taken to Ramna cop shoppe where the police tortured him for giving confessional statement.

But police pressed charges against Jama'atul Mujahedin Bangladesh members in the case while dropping Abbas' name from the charge sheet on November 15 of 2007 after a probe.

After getting bail from the court, Abbas, also a student of Political Science of Dhaka University, filed the case with the Dhaka Chief Metropolitan Magistrate's Court on March 5 of 2008 accusing Babar, Mahbubur Rahman and three other police officials for torturing.

After the hearing, the court directed detective branch (DB) of police to submit a report after an investigation. But DB had earlier submitted a final report finding no evidence about the torture on the victim.

Later on July 23 last year, the court had directed CID to probe the matter and submit a report on it. The CID investigated the matter and recorded statements of several people including some accused who were in Ramna cop shoppe and found their involvement in torturing Abbas.

Italy seizes huge explosives cache
[Al Jazeera] Italian police have seized seven tonnes of the powerful RDX explosives from a container ship believed to be on its way to Syria, according to authorities.

Anti-mafia police found the explosives hidden in a shipment of powdered milk at the port of Gioia Tauro in southern Calabria, Italian news agencies reported.

Carmelo Casabona, the region's police chief, said investigators are not yet sure of who was in control of the shipment, but it appeared that it originally travelled from Iran.

Also known as T4, RDX is a powerful military grade explosive that has been used in several devastating attacks believed to have been carried out by the Italian mafia in past years.

It was most notably used in the assassinations of anti-mafia judges Giovanni Falcone and Paolo Borsellino, the former being blown up with his wife and three bodyguards after a bomb exploded under a motorway.

Casabona said the cargo had "the involvement of international criminal organisations," but ruled out the involvement of local mafia, know as the Ndrangheta, saying the shipment was too large.

The cargo was reportedly found on a Liberian-registered ship called the Finland, which is owned by an Italian-Swiss company, MSC. However the company has not yet confirmed the story to the media.

Russia will not supply Iran with S-300 missiles
[Al Arabiya] Russia has dropped plans to supply Iran with S-300 missiles because they are subject to international sanctions, a top general said on Wednesday, in the strongest confirmation yet of the leadership's intentions to put the controversial sale on ice.

"A decision has been taken not to supply the S-300 to Iran, they undoubtedly fall under sanctions," the chief of the general staff Nikolai Makarov said in an apparent reference to U.N. sanctions, the ITAR-TASS news agency reported.

"There was a decision by the leadership to stop the supply process, we are carrying it out," Makarov was quoted as saying.
